  • Dive into a world of romance, village life, and even a little silliness in this stunning edition of Jane Austen’s timeless novel, Emma. Self-satisfied Emma Woodhouse thinks she is above romance of any kind, but when she decides she is a great matchmaker and sets out to find a wealthy husband for her friend, the sweet yet pitiable Harriet Smith, she crosses paths with the charming Mr. Knightley. Even though Emma tries to ignore her feelings for him, she ends up marrying him and realizes that “Perfect happiness, even in memory, is not common.” This collectible edition of Emma features: An elegant faux-leather cover with foil-embossed designs Introduction by English literature scholar Alison Fraser Unabridged text A timeline of the life and times of Jane Austen This lovely classic is a perfect gift or a wonderful addition to your home library.
